About this Virtual Instructor Led Training (VILT)

Exploration and production technology, equipment specification and processes have a unique language that must be conquered by executives such as you. A confident understanding of the technical jargon and a visual appreciation of the various pieces of equipment used provides for an overall “big picture” of industry value chain. This serves as an excellent foundation for smooth communication and increased efficiency in inter-department project team efforts.

Gain a comprehensive overview of the entire value chain and process of oil & gas upstream operations and business in this 5 half-day Virtual Instructor Led Training (VILT) course.

By attending this industry fundamentals Virtual Instructor Led Training (VILT) course, participants will be better able to:

  • Appreciate the dynamics of world energy demand & supply and its impact on pricing
  • Understand the formation of petroleum reservoirs and basic geological considerations
  • Examine the exploration process to gain an overview of the technical processes involved
  • Gain a comprehensive overview of drilling activities – from pre-drilling preparation, through to well drilling, well evaluations and post drilling activities
  • Get familiarised with the common production methods and the different stages of its processes
  • Integrate your understanding of asset maintenance and downstream supply chain activities
  • Better visualise through video presentations the various exploration equipment/ technologies and understand the major cost components

Your second expert course instructor has over 45 years of experience in the Oil & Gas industry. During that time, he has worked exclusively in the well engineering domain. After being employed in 1974 by Shell, one of the major oil & gas producing operators, he worked as an apprentice on drilling rigs in the Netherlands. After a year, he was sent for his first international assignment to the Sultanate of Oman where he climbed up the career ladder from Assistant Driller, to Driller, to wellsite Petroleum Engineer and eventually on-site Drilling Supervisor, actively engaged in the drilling of development and exploration wells in almost every corner of this vast desert area.

He was also assigned to research, to projects and to the company’s learning centre. In research, he was responsible for promoting directional drilling and surveying and advised on the first horizontal wells being drilled, in projects, he was responsible for a high pressure drilling campaign in Nigeria while in the learning centre, he looked after the development of new engineers joining the company after graduating from university. He was also involved in international well control certification and served as chairman for a period of three years. In the last years of his active career, he worked again in China as a staff development manager, a position he nurtured because he was able to pass on his knowledge to a vast number of new employees once again.
